+[[ubuntu-ppa]]
+=== Ubuntu: noch:{LTTng} Stable {revision} PPA
+
+The https://launchpad.net/~lttng/+archive/ubuntu/stable-{revision}[LTTng
+Stable{nbsp}{revision} PPA] offers the latest stable
+LTTng{nbsp}{revision} packages for Ubuntu{nbsp}16.04 _Xenial Xerus_ and
+Ubuntu{nbsp}18.04 _Bionic Beaver_.
+
+To install LTTng{nbsp}{revision} from the LTTng Stable{nbsp}{revision}
+PPA:
+
+. Add the LTTng Stable{nbsp}{revision} PPA repository and update the
+ list of packages:
++
+--
+[role="term"]
+----
+# apt-add-repository ppa:lttng/stable-2.11
+# apt-get update
+----
+--
+
+. Install the main LTTng{nbsp}{revision} packages:
++
+--
+[role="term"]
+----
+# apt-get install lttng-tools
+# apt-get install lttng-modules-dkms
+# apt-get install liblttng-ust-dev
+----
+--
+
+. **If you need to instrument and trace
+ <<java-application,Java applications>>**, install the LTTng-UST
+ Java agent:
++
+--
+[role="term"]
+----
+# apt-get install liblttng-ust-agent-java
+----
+--
+
+. **If you need to instrument and trace
+ <<python-application,Python{nbsp}3 applications>>**, install the
+ LTTng-UST Python agent:
++
+--
+[role="term"]
+----
+# apt-get install python3-lttngust
+----
+--

+[[fedora]]
+=== Fedora
+
+To install LTTng{nbsp}{revision} on Fedora{nbsp}32:
+
+. Install the LTTng-tools{nbsp}{revision} and LTTng-UST{nbsp}{revision}
+ packages:
++
+--
+[role="term"]
+----
+# yum install lttng-tools
+# yum install lttng-ust
+----
+--
+
+. Download, build, and install the latest LTTng-modules{nbsp}{revision}:
++
+--
+[role="term"]
+----
+$ cd $(mktemp -d) &&
+wget http://lttng.org/files/lttng-modules/lttng-modules-latest-2.11.tar.bz2 &&
+tar -xf lttng-modules-latest-2.11.tar.bz2 &&
+cd lttng-modules-2.11.* &&
+make &&
+sudo make modules_install &&
+sudo depmod -a
+----
+--
+
+[IMPORTANT]
+.Java and Python application instrumentation and tracing
+====
+If you need to instrument and trace <<java-application,Java
+applications>> on Fedora, you need to build and install
+LTTng-UST{nbsp}{revision} <<building-from-source,from source>> and pass
+the `--enable-java-agent-jul`, `--enable-java-agent-log4j`, or
+`--enable-java-agent-all` options to the `configure` script, depending
+on which Java logging framework you use.
+
+If you need to instrument and trace <<python-application,Python
+applications>> on Fedora, you need to build and install
+LTTng-UST{nbsp}{revision} from source and pass the
+`--enable-python-agent` option to the `configure` script.
+====

+[[buildroot]]
+=== Buildroot
+
+To install LTTng{nbsp}{revision} on Buildroot{nbsp}2019.11,
+Buildroot{nbsp}2020.02, or Buildroot{nbsp}2020.05:
+
+. Launch the Buildroot configuration tool:
++
+--
+[role="term"]
+----
+$ make menuconfig
+----
+--
+
+. In **Kernel**, check **Linux kernel**.
+. In **Toolchain**, check **Enable WCHAR support**.
+. In **Target packages**{nbsp}→ **Debugging, profiling and benchmark**,
+ check **lttng-modules** and **lttng-tools**.
+. In **Target packages**{nbsp}→ **Libraries**{nbsp}→
+ **Other**, check **lttng-libust**.

+[[oe-yocto]]
+=== OpenEmbedded and Yocto
+
+LTTng{nbsp}{revision} recipes are available in the
+https://layers.openembedded.org/layerindex/branch/master/layer/openembedded-core/[`openembedded-core`]
+layer for Yocto Project{nbsp}3.1 _Dunfell_ under the following names:
+
+* `lttng-tools`
+* `lttng-modules`
+* `lttng-ust`
+
+With BitBake, the simplest way to include LTTng recipes in your target
+image is to add them to `IMAGE_INSTALL_append` in path:{conf/local.conf}:
+
+----
+IMAGE_INSTALL_append = " lttng-tools lttng-modules lttng-ust"
+----
+
+If you use Hob:
+
+. Select a machine and an image recipe.
+. Click **Edit image recipe**.
+. Under the **All recipes** tab, search for **lttng**.
+. Check the desired LTTng recipes.
